Look at warnings when buying toys for small children. Some toys are hazardous to small children, and you need to pay attention to any warnings indicating this. Toys normally come with ratings that advise the appropriate age ranges for its use, so be sure to read that information.
When purchasing a toy for a child, always take into consideration the space where the toy will be used. If you buy a large toy, lots of space will be needed for it. Think about where the toy will be placed, both when it is being played with and when it is not.
Read the warnings on the back of a toy for safety purposes. These provide important information that help keep your children safe when using the products. Toys suited for older children should not find the hands of younger children.
Before getting something from the local toy store, check out what the prices are online. Sometimes, you can find much better deals on the Internet. Particularly during the holiday season, this strategy can help you save quite a bit of cash. Online sales often go on for many months during this time of year.
When buying baby toys, it’s important to choose toys that are age appropriate. Select colorful, lightweight toys that are composed of many different textural components. Smaller children learn by using all of their senses. Additionally, any toys you buy for babies must be non toxic.
Consider looking at second hand stores for inexpensive toy gifts. But, if you purchase toys from these stores, clean them prior to giving them to your child. You won’t know where these toys were in the past and you don’t need to get germs that pass onto the child of yours.
Try looking into project-based toys for your children. Kits that allow you to make airplanes, rockets and other vessels are great for children that are older. Ant farms and chemistry or science kits are also great choices. These help kids with following directions, critical thinking, and reading comprehension.
